This is curious: InfiniteApple is saying they’ve confirmed that iCloud is powered by Microsoft’s Azure, at least for the moment.

The folks at InfiniteApple sent files to and from iPhones with iOS 5 beta installed and monitored the traffic. They concluded that iCloud doesn’t actually store anything. Instead, it simply “manages links” to content stored elsewhere—in this case, Microsoft’s Azure services. iCloud’s still in beta, so this may be a temporary solution. Still, how great would it be if the defining feature of Apple’s year turns out to be powered by Microsoft? [InfiniteApple via ZDnet]
